Identifying Wet Exact Diagnosis For All Kinds Of Wetness Since no EPA or various other government limitations have been set for mold and mildew or mold spores, sampling can not be utilized to examine a building's compliance with federal mold and mildew criteria. Surface area tasting may serve to identify if a location has actually been adequately cleansed or remediated. Tasting for mold must be conducted by experts who have particular experience in developing mold and mildew sampling methods, sampling methods, and interpreting outcomes. Sample evaluation ought to comply with logical techniques suggested by the American Industrial Hygiene Organization (AIHA), the American Conference of Governmental Industrial Hygienists (ACGIH), or other specialist companies.

Recognizing the dirts in the location of a suggested seepage best management technique (BMP) aids establish the viability and style of the BMP. Soils identify how quickly stormwater will certainly penetrate, influence plant development, and influence the destiny and transportation of toxins. Area 16.10 of the Building Stormwater basic permit states "Permittees should give at least one dirt boring, test pit or infiltrometer test in the place of the infiltration method for determining seepage prices". A rapid calcium carbide damp test is a technique made use of for detecting wet by wet experts to establish the dampness content within wet walls in houses. This moist examination procedure helps our surveyors when Home Modification investigating a property for moist and assists to determine an exact diagnosis of the wetness within a property. A fast carbide test has a higher degree of accuracy when contrasted to a Protimeter that likewise figures out the dampness levels within a moist wall surface.

The carbide technique can be executed on site taking about 3-5 minutes per example. However, it can not distinguish between ground moisture and hygroscopic wetness, though comparisons between samples taken from the surface and deeper in the wall can give a great sign.
